Katalog książek

Wydawnictwo Helion

Helion SA
ul. Kościuszki 1c
44-100 Gliwice
tel. (32) 230-98-63




© Helion 1991-2016

Lauret zaufanych opinii
JavaScript - mocne strony

JavaScript - mocne strony

Autor: 

JavaScript - mocne strony
Ocena:
   5/6  Opinie  (32)
Stron: 160 Stron (w wersji papierowej): 160
Ksiazka drukowana Druk (oprawa: miękka) 3w1 w pakiecie: PdfPDF ePubePub MobiMobi
Wydawca: Helion
Cena:
39,90 zł
Cena:
27,90 zł
Dodaj do koszyka
Kup terazstrzalka

Druk
Książka drukowana
39,90 zł
eBook
Pdf ePub Mobi
27,90 zł

Poznaj doskonałą użyteczność języka JavaScript!

  • Jak efektywnie wykorzystać najlepsze funkcje JavaScript?
  • Jak pisać programy, aby ustrzec się błędów?
  • Jak zdefiniować podzbiór języka i tworzyć idealne aplikacje?

Warto poznać język JavaScript, ponieważ stanowi on jedno z ważniejszych narzędzi w informatyce -- dzięki temu, że jest jednocześnie podstawowym i domyślnym językiem przeglądarek internetowych oraz językiem programowania. JavaScript pozwala na tworzenie wydajnego kodu bibliotek obiektowych czy aplikacji opartych na technice AJAX. Jego skrypty służą najczęściej do zapewniania interaktywności, sprawdzania poprawności formularzy oraz budowania elementów nawigacyjnych. Dość łatwa składnia sprawia, że pisanie pełnoprawnych i wydajnych aplikacji w tym języku nie jest trudne nawet dla początkujących programistów.

Książka "JavaScript -- mocne strony" to wyjątkowy podręcznik do nauki tego popularnego, dynamicznego języka programowania. Dowiesz się z niej, jak efektywnie wykorzystać wszystkie jego mocne strony (m.in. funkcje, dynamiczne obiekty, literały obiektowe) oraz jak unikać pułapek. Poznasz elementy składowe języka oraz sposoby ich łączenia, zrozumiesz, na czym polega dziedziczenie prototypowe, w jaki sposób brak kontroli typów ma pozytywny wpływ na pisanie aplikacji oraz dlaczego stosowanie zmiennych globalnych jako podstawowego modelu programowania nie jest dobrym pomysłem. Znając wszelkie ograniczenia języka JavaScript, będziesz mógł profesjonalnie wykorzystać jego najlepsze części.

  • Gramatyka języka JavaScript
  • Obiekty i funkcje
  • Rekurencja
  • Kaskadowe łączenie wywołań
  • Literały obiektowe
  • Dziedziczenie -- pseudoklasyczne, prototypowe, funkcyjne
  • Tablice
  • Wyrażenia regularne
  • Klasa znaków i kwantyfikator wyrażenia regularnego

Nie trać czasu -- sięgaj tylko po to, co najlepsze w języku JavaScript!

Wstęp (9)
1. Mocne strony (11)
  • Dlaczego JavaScript? (12)
  • Analizując JavaScript (12)
  • Prosta platforma testowa (14)
2. Gramatyka (15)
  • Białe znaki (15)
  • Nazwy (16)
  • Liczby (17)
  • Łańcuchy znakowe (18)
  • Instrukcje (20)
  • Wyrażenia (24)
  • Literały (27)
  • Funkcje (28)
3. Obiekty (29)
  • Literały obiektowe (29)
  • Pobieranie (30)
  • Modyfikacja (30)
  • Referencja (31)
  • Prototyp (31)
  • Refleksja (32)
  • Wyliczanie (32)
  • Usuwanie (33)
  • Ograniczanie liczby zmiennych globalnych (33)
4. Funkcje (35)
  • Obiekty funkcji (35)
  • Literał funkcji (36)
  • Wywołanie (36)
  • Argumenty (39)
  • Powrót z funkcji (40)
  • Wyjątki (40)
  • Rozszerzanie typów (41)
  • Rekurencja (42)
  • Zasięg (43)
  • Domknięcia (44)
  • Wywołania zwrotne (47)
  • Moduł (47)
  • Kaskadowe łączenie wywołań (49)
  • Funkcja curry (50)
  • Spamiętywanie (51)
5. Dziedziczenie (53)
  • Dziedziczenie pseudoklasyczne (53)
  • Określenia obiektów (56)
  • Dziedziczenie prototypowe (56)
  • Dziedziczenie funkcyjne (58)
  • Części (61)
6. Tablice (63)
  • Literały tablicowe (63)
  • Długość tablicy (64)
  • Usuwanie elementów (65)
  • Wyliczanie (65)
  • Problem z rozpoznawaniem typu (65)
  • Metody (66)
  • Wymiary (67)
7. Wyrażenia regularne (69)
  • Przykład (70)
  • Tworzenie (74)
  • Elementy (75)
8. Metody (81)
9. Styl (97)
10. Najpiękniejsze cechy języka (101)
Dodatek A: Kłopotliwe cechy języka (105)
Dodatek B: Nietrafione cechy języka (113)
Dodatek C: JSLint (119)
Dodatek D: Diagramy składni (129)
Dodatek E: JSON (139)
Skorowidz (149)
Najczęściej kupowane razem:
JavaScript - mocne strony plus Tajniki języka JavaScript. Typy i składnia plus Tajniki języka JavaScript. Zakresy i domknięcia
Cena zestawu: 88,98 zł 104,70 zł
Oszczędzasz: 15,72 zł (15%)
Dodaj do koszyka
zestaw0 JavaScript - mocne strony
Najczęściej kupowane razem ebooki:
JavaScript - mocne strony plus Tajniki języka JavaScript. Typy i składnia plus Tajniki języka JavaScript. Wskaźnik this i prototypy obiektów
Cena zestawu: 74,61 zł 87,79 zł
Oszczędzasz: 13,18 zł (15%)
Dodaj do koszyka
zestaw0 JavaScript - mocne strony
Osoby, które kupowały książkę, często kupowały też:
Osoby, które kupowały książkę, często kupowały też:
6
(16)
5
(8)
4
(4)
3
(3)
2
(1)
1
(0)

Liczba ocen: 32

Średnia ocena
czytelników

  


okladka
  Ocena : 6 

Bez zbędnego lania wody - moim zdaniem pozycja obowiązkowa
  Ocena : 6 

Pozycja obowiązkowa dla każdego javascriptowca.
  Ocena : 6 

Książka Douglasa Crockforda, co tu dużo mówić, jest świetna, zwięzła i przejrzysta.
  Ocena : 6 

Książka z kategorii ciężkich ale dobitnie i szczegółowo wyjaśniających JavaScript. Jej lektura jest męcząca ale to dlatego że każda ze stron przepełniona jest konkretnymi i znaczącymi informacjami. Treści, które ze sobą niesie pozwalają po prostu na pisanie lepszych skryptów. Zdecydowanie polecam.
  Ocena : 6 

.
  Ocena : 6 

Niby mało stron, ale treść tak skompresowana, że trzeba czytać z wielką uwagą. Po prostu bez owijania i sztucznego rozpychania objętości książki, czysta wiedza. Zdecydowanie polecam każdemu.
  Ocena : 6 

Pozycja obowiązkowa dla każdego frontendowca.
  Ocena : 6 

Książka w bardzo fajny sposób omawia to co w JavaScript najfajniejsze i o czym wiele ludzi, którzy twierdzą, że znają JS nie zdają sobie sprawy. Jestem zadowolony z jej zakupu - w internecie jest pełno śmieci na temat JS i często dużo błędnych przykładów.
  Ocena : 6 

Jedna z najlepszych książek ale tłumaczenie na polskie może trochę zmienić tłumaczenie. Polecam też przeczytać oryginał np w pdf którego w necie jest mase
  Ocena : 6 

Od tej książki powinni zaczynać wszyscy, którzy zaczynają swoją przygodę z językiem JavaScript. Unikanie złych nawyków i wykorzystanie pełni możliwości języka, to jest właśnie to, czego potrzeba wszystkim programistom. Bardzo, bardzo polecam.
  Ocena : 6 

Książka, którą musi przeczytać i wziąć do serca każdy kto zajmuje się dzisiaj i będzie się zajmował programowaniem aplikacji 'webowych'. Pokazuje w jaki sposób spośród chaotycznie skonstruowanego języka jakim jest JacaScript można wydobyć to co w nim najlepsze i tym samym usprawnić swoje aplikacje ale i również stać się lepszym programistą. To co dla mnie jest najważniejsze w tej książce to zdecydowanie nakreślenie niebezpieczeństw jakimi niektóre cechy tego języka są obarczone i w jaki sposób powinniśmy ich unikać. Polecam!
  Ocena : 6 

Cena dość wysoka jak na grubość książki, jednak dałbym nawet dwa razy tyle za treści, które z sobą niesie. Zdecydowanie odradzam ją programistą, którzy dopiero niedawno zaczęli swoją naukę. Są to bardziej "smaczki" z JavaScriptu, które warto znać trochę z innej perspektywy. Polecam, ale tylko dla na prawdę wprawionych w ten język programistów.
  Ocena : 6 

Pozycja obowiązkowa. Żadnego bezsensownego lania wody a wszystko to podane w przystępnej formie.
  Ocena : 6 

Wspaniała książka, dużo konkretnej wiedzy, która przyda się każdemu programiście, nie tylko Javascript. Esencja tego języka.
  Ocena : 6 

Książka jest po prostu obowiązkowa dla każdego front-end developera. Chyba jedna z najlepszych książek w tym temacie. Pomaga zrozumieć JavaScript i nabrać dobrych nawyków. Bardzo polecam!
  Ocena : 6 

Świetna książka (raczej nie dla początkujących w programowaniu jako takim choć niekoniecznie w JS). Pokazuje o co tak naprawdę chodzi w JS (dziedziczenie prototypowe, funkcje będące obiektami) zamiast niepotrzebnie wnikać w podstawy i niuanse języka. Zdecydowanie warta przeczytania jeśli chce się przyzwoicie zrozumieć JavaScript.
  Ocena : 5 

Same konkrety
  Ocena : 5 

Bardzo dobra książka, jednak nie doskonała. W sam raz dla osoby takiej jak ja, która miała już sporą styczność z tym językiem, jednak chce zgłębić jej tajemnice. Miejscami tłumaczenie nie jest jasne, przez co kilka fragmentów musiałem doczytać w wersji oryginalnej. Na minus jest też fakt, że niektóre zagadnienia są tłumaczone na podstawie funkcji napisanych wcześniej w książce, co uniemożliwia skupienia się jedynie na interesujących zagadnieniach i zmusza do przeczytania całej książki od początku. Niektóre zagadnienia były dla mnie trudniejsze do zrozumienia i wymagały skakania po całej książce. Książka jednak jest na tyle wartościowa, że warto się z nią zapoznać przed przystąpieniem do dalszego zgłębiania się w szczegóły języka. Pozwala bardzo dobrze usystematyzować wiedzę. Polecam.
  Ocena : 5 

Książka może nie dla początkujących. Wymaga trochę też trochę "podbudowy teoretycznej". Ale bardzo dobra. Choć w przypadku papieru bym się pewnie zirytował na końcowe diagramy zajmujące sporo miejsca (tak więc "treści" jest tam ze 20% mniej niżby wynikało z ilości stron) w przypadku ebooka to tak nie boli. Należy przy tym dodać, że autor prezentuje w niej swoje zdanie na styl programowania. Można się z nim zgadzać (zmienne globalne) lub nie (np. instrukcja "with") ale widać, że trochę kodu on napisał.
  Ocena : 5 

Bardzo dobra książka dla programistów chcących wyciągnąć z języka to co najlepsze. Przystępnie opisane cechy języka, które odróżniają go od innych. W szczególności rozdział o dziedziczeniu wydał mi się interesujący.
  Ocena : 5 

Bardzo dobra książka. Nic dodać nic ująć. Raczej dla zaawansowanych.
  Ocena : 5 

Dobra książka, ale nie dla początkujących. Warto mieć już trochę doświadczenia w programowaniu w innych językach, pierwsze kroki w JavaScripcie też dobrze już mieć za sobą. Czasami przydałyby się dłuższe wyjaśnienia albo większa ilość przykładów. Rozdział o wyrażeniach regularnych jest moim zdaniem, jeśli się ich wcześniej nie używało, nie do przejścia. Książka ma 150 stron, ale właściwa część kończy się po 100 i zaczynają się dodatki. Niektóre z nich zawierają nowe rzeczy, inne to praktycznie powtórzenia i zestawienia rzeczy, które już były. Książka jest wbrew pozorom dość droga. 150 stron, z których powiedzmy 20 to powtórzenia, za 35zł to dość sporo. Jeśli chodzi o naukę JavaScript, to moim zdaniem warto mieć tą książkę, a podstaw można się nauczyć z internetu, szczególnie filmów autora tej książki, które można znaleźć na video.yahoo.com po wyszukaniu frazy: Douglas Crockford: "The JavaScript Programming Language" Pozdrawiam.
  Ocena : 5 

Książka nie jest przeznaczona dla rozpoczynających naukę JavaScriptu, przyda się także pewna wiedza nt. dziedziczenia w innych językach tzw klasycznych. Ale jest dobrze napisana i przetłumaczona i dla mnie stanowi duży krok w poznaniu JavaScriptu. Błędów (na razie) nie zauważyłem. Stanowczo polecam dla zainteresowanych.
  Ocena : 5 

Nie jest przegadana, i nie jest kolejną książką z cyklu "Znam C++ - jak mam pisać w JS?"
  Ocena : 4 

Książka legenda. Nie jest to typowy podręcznik od zera do developera, czasami nie trzyma poziomu, przechodząc z trudnych zagadnień do czystej dokumentacji, pozycja trudna ale można z niej wyciągnąć ciekawą wiedzę, której jednak nie jest wiele. Dla koneserów.
  Ocena : 4 

Solidna rzemieślnicza robota tylko tyle i aż tyle
  Ocena : 4 

Polecam
  Ocena : 4 

Książka dobra, porusza wiele ważnych tematów pozwalając się zagłębić w mechanizmy JS. Natomiast przykłady często są omówione w sposób, w mojej opinii, mało przystępny. Trzeba włożyć sporo wysiłku w zrozumienie tego o czym pisze autor.
  Ocena : 3 

Książka chaotyczna. Brak jakiegoś ciągu informacyjnego. de facto 100 stron opisu języka, 1/3 ksiązki to dodatki( ???? ), niektóre można było potraktować jako rozdziały początkowe i wprowadzające w tematykę. Zwięzły sposób prezentacji wiedzy aż za bardzo zwięzły, przykłady nie chcą działać, trzeba się chwile zastanowić co autor miał na myśli i szukać w innych źródłach czy dana metoda to składowa języka czy wymysła autora, który bedzie o dziwo zdefiniowany 2 strony dalej. Coś co mnie osobiśice bardzo zabolało jak czytałem tą ksiązkę to fakt że autor nie kryje niechęci do języka, co automatycznie obniża motywację czytelnika. Jak komuś potrzebe są bardziej zaawansowane aspekty JS to polecam książkę JavaScript Wzorce, trudniejsza ale lepiej zorganizowana niż ta.
  Ocena : 3 

Treść podobna co w książce "Javascript Wzorce Projektowe", z tym że tam zagadnienia są lepiej i bardziej kompleksowo omówione. Od połowy książki pojawiają się tutaj jakieś diagramy i cały przykładowy kod "parsera JSON", które są zwyczajną zapchaj dziurą. Książka zła nie jest, ale na pewno są od niej lepsze (szczególnie wspomniane Wzorce, których ta jest po części kopią).
  Ocena : 3 

Książka przeznaczona zdecydowanie dla osób zaawansowanych. Jeśli ktoś ma tylko podstawy JavaScript to jest po prostu niestrawna.
  Ocena : 2 

Wady: - cena(defakto jest tu 100 stron konkretnych opisów języka) - bardzo zwięzłe wytłumaczenie poruszanych problemów - brak stopniowania trudności(czyli od początku na grubo) - początkujący nie ma co się za nią zabierać - przykłady na ftp(w żadnej książce nie widziałem gorszych) nie wiem skąd taki oryginalny pomysł by dac je w pliku .txt(beznadzieja), poza tym po otwarciu któregoś przykładu można się mocno wkurc. Brak tu jakiegokolwiek normalnego działającego przykładu, tylko surowe dane.PASKUDA - w dobie jquery i innych bibliotek praktycznie nie korzysta się z własnej implementacji dziedziczenia, i innych tematów poruszanych w ksiązce - niektóre rozdziały są nie potrzebne jak np."Wyrażenia regularne"(jeśli osoba początkująca zrozumie choć połowę ma u mnie dożywotni zapas piwa) ZALETY: - autorytet autora - zwięzłość(cho nie do końca) - zaawansowane tematy - satysfakcje ze zrozumienia poruszanych wątków Tak więc dziwie się osobiście skąd tyle pochwał jaka to wspaniałość. Moja ocena to 3-. Polecam jednak inną książke w której są opisywane podobne rzeczy "JavaScript wzorce projektowe" tu wszystko wygląda o niebo lepiej